近年来,由于智能手机和平板电脑的普及,移动应用程序越来越受欢迎,成为了人们生活和工作中必不可少的一部分。自己做一本书的app可以利用这一趋势,为读者提供一个更加便捷、实用的阅读方式。
实现自己做一本书的app,需要掌握以下几方面的知识:
1. 前端开发:通过使用HTML、CSS、JavaScript等技术,构建app的用户交互界面。这些技术将负责处理如何显示书籍、如何与用户进行交互以及如何展示书籍中的各种元素。
2. 后端开发:建立一个可靠的数据存储系统,将书籍信息和读者信息进行存储和管理。后端开发还应处理用户注册、登录、购买等功能。
3. 服务器架构:建立一个稳定的服务器架构来管理用户的数据、保护用户数据以及确保安全性。
4. 数据库管理:在服务器上建立一个文档库,以便存储图书、作者和其他相关信息,这对内容提供商、作者和阅读者来说都是至关重要的。
以下是自己做一本书的app的具体实现步骤:
1. 定义功能和需求:在开始制作应用程序之前,应该清楚地定义应用程序所需的功能和满足读者的需求。通过分析市场趋势和竞争对手的特点来确定所需的最佳功能,例如在目录页面添加搜索功能。
2. 决定合适的开发工具:选择合适的开发工具,比如Ionic、React Native、Flutter等等。这些开发工具可以快速地构建app,并集成了大量的组件、插件和API,可以帮助开发人员更快地完成自己做一本书的app。
3. 开发前端框架:开发人员使用HTML、CSS、JavaScript等技术构建app,包括设置图书查看器、目录界面、书签、翻页、进度栏等功能。
4. 开发后端框架:建立一个可靠的数据存储系统,将书籍信息和读者信息进行存储和管理。后端开发还应处理用户注册、登录、购买等功能。
5. 建立服务器架构:建立服务器,部署应用程序,并建立一个稳定的服务器架构来管理用户的数据、保护用户数据以及确保安全性等。
6. 实现付费功能:通过将应用程序与付费网关集成,可以让读者通过应用程序购买付费内容并实现在线支付功能。
总的来说,自己做一本书的app需要确定必要的功能和需求,选择合适的开发工具,构建应用程序的前端和后端框架,建立稳定的服务器架构,实现付费功能等等。这些步骤可以帮助开发人员快速而顺利地完成自己做一本书的app的开发。